The team pointed to strong demand for the Ford Pro commercial vehicle segment, which continued to benefit from fleet and government orders. On the electric vehicle front, the company noted that production of the next-generation electric pickup is progressing on schedule, with management emphasizing a measured approach to scaling output in line with market demand. Operationally, Ford cited improvements in supply chain stability and manufacturing efficiency, particularly at key assembly plants, which supported higher production volumes compared to the prior quarter. The Michigan Assembly Plant’s transition to new models was described as proceeding smoothly. However, management acknowledged persistent cost pressures, especially related to raw materials and logistics, and reiterated a focus on cost discipline across the organization. International operations, especially in Europe and South America, showed steady performance, though currency headwinds remained a minor challenge. Overall, the tone was cautiously optimistic, with executives stressing that the company would maintain flexibility in adjusting production and investment in response to evolving market conditions. Forward Guidance

Looking ahead, Ford management provided a cautiously optimistic outlook for the remainder of 2026, emphasizing continued progress on its cost-reduction initiatives and the ongoing transition to electric vehicles. The company reaffirmed its expectation for full-year adjusted EBIT to land in the range previously communicated, though it acknowledged that macroeconomic uncertainties, including potential shifts in consumer demand and raw material costs, could influence results. Ford anticipates that its Pro segment will remain a key growth driver, with steady demand for commercial vehicles and fleet orders. However, the Model e division may continue to face headwinds from competitive pricing pressures and the pace of EV adoption, which could weigh on near-term profitability. Management also highlighted that supply chain improvements and reduced warranty expenses should support margins in the coming quarters. On the capital allocation front, Ford expects to maintain its dividend and may continue opportunistic share repurchases, balancing shareholder returns with investments in future product launches. The guidance implies that the company is navigating a transition period, with potential for earnings stability if operational efficiencies materialize as planned. Analysts will watch for further clarity on EV roadmap details and progress toward the cost-saving targets when Ford provides its next update. The market’s immediate response was measured, with shares trading modestly higher in the extended session following the announcement. Investors appeared to focus on the earnings beat, though the absence of revenue details left some uncertainty about top-line momentum. Analysts covering the automaker noted that the EPS outperformance suggests cost controls and favorable product mix may have offset ongoing challenges in the EV transition and pricing pressure. Several firms reiterated cautious near-term outlooks, pointing to potential headwinds from tariff uncertainties and inventory adjustments. While the stock price reaction was positive, gains were capped as the broader market remains attuned to macroeconomic risks, including consumer spending trends and interest rate sensitivity. Volume during the after-hours session was above average, indicating active rebalancing by institutional participants. Technical conditions for the stock may be shifting; the price response indicates that the low end of its recent trading range could see renewed support. However, without full revenue data, some analysts advise waiting for the management call to assess underlying demand and margin trajectory. Overall, the market’s reaction reflects cautious optimism, with the EPS beat providing a near-term catalyst while longer-term questions persist about Ford’s competitive positioning.
